Why is my airbag light on in my dodge caravan?

Why is my airbag light on in my dodge caravan? Problem Description The airbag warning light may remain illuminated while the ignition switch is in the "on" position. This can be caused by water that has entered into the airbag six-way connector in the engine compartment. How to read and reset SRS / airbag light? Battery dying. How to read and reset SRS/ Airbag light? Very often the SRS/Airbag light goes on mainly because of a dying battery. Why does my Dodge Grand Caravan lock all the time?

Why does my Dodge Grand Caravan lock all the time? The actuator’s motor may emit a groaning or grinding noise that indicates it’s on its way out. If the door lock actuators cycle continuously, causing the doors to lock and unlock all day long without prompting, this action may drain the battery. Can tie rods cause tire wear?

Can tie rods cause tire wear? A damaged tie rod can cause uneven or excessive tire wear. Do a visual inspection of your tires; if they display excessive wear on one side but not as much wear on the other side, it may be a sign of a failing tie rod. Can you just drain upstairs radiators?

Can you just drain upstairs radiators? Go around your house ensuring that all the radiator valves are open, then go back to your radiator with the attached hosepipe and open up the valve. All the water will start to drain out. To get the water to drain out more quickly and effectively, go upstairs and open the bleed valves on all of your upstairs radiators.
